A person who is regarded as a follower of Satan, or who adheres to beliefs or doctrines regarded as diabolically wicked or evil. Later also: a worshipper of Satan; = "Satanist".
Late 17th century; earliest use found in Edward Stillingfleet (1635–1699), bishop of Worcester and theologian. From Satan + -ite.
